Tony Evans, Chuck Swindoll, Donald Trump pay respect to Charles Stanley at legacy celebration

“We have all been impacted, influenced and transformed by his ministry locally, nationally and internationally."

Prominent Pastors Tony Evans and Chuck Swindoll, as well as former President Donald Trump, were among those who paid their respects to the late Pastor Charles Stanley at a legacy celebration held at his church on Sunday.

The service was held at First Baptist Church of Atlanta, Georgia, where Stanley served as senior pastor for nearly 50 years, and featured several musical selections and messages of remembrance given in person and via video.
